1900s Hallmarked sterling silver handled bowl accompanied with original base. Finley detailed with claw feet. Bowl has handles. Diameter of the bowl is 11.5″ Diameter of the base is 12″ Engraved with presentation of a horse race in Latonia Jockey Club in Latonia, Kentucky in 1929.
